Introduction to Automatic Splicing Machine Market Dynamics

Automatic splicing machines have emerged as critical assets in high-precision cable and fiber termination processes, driving consistency, speed, and reliability across multiple industries. As automation demands intensify, manufacturers are investing in systems capable of handling increasingly complex materials and intricate geometries, thereby reducing human error and labor costs. The integration of digital controls, advanced optics, and adaptive algorithms has elevated these machines from simple tools to dynamic production partners. Moreover, heightened quality standards in sectors such as aerospace and telecommunications have placed automatic splicing machinery at the forefront of product development strategies.

In this context, understanding technological advancements, regulatory changes, and evolving customer requirements is essential for stakeholders seeking to capitalize on emerging opportunities. Transformative Shifts in the Automatic Splicing Landscape

Over the past five years, the landscape of automatic splicing technology has undergone transformative shifts driven by digitization, sustainability mandates, and advanced materials. First, the rise of Industry 4.0 has accelerated the adoption of intelligent networking and real-time monitoring, enabling predictive maintenance and remote diagnostics. Second, environmental regulations and customer demand for eco-friendly processes have spurred the development of energy-efficient servo motors and low-emission ultrasonic systems. Third, miniaturization trends in medical devices and consumer electronics have pushed engineers to refine splice tolerances to micrometer levels, necessitating enhanced laser alignment and adaptive clamp designs.

In parallel, strategic partnerships between robotics integrators and machine manufacturers have enabled seamless end-to-end automation, from cable feeding to heat-shrink application. Open-architecture control platforms now facilitate rapid software updates, while modular machine frames support swift reconfiguration for diverse production runs. Taken together, these advancements redefine operational benchmarks, elevate throughput, and foster resilience against supply chain disruptions.

Cumulative Impact of United States Tariffs in 2025

The introduction of new United States tariffs in 2025 has had a cumulative impact on the automatic splicing machine ecosystem, reshaping both cost structures and sourcing strategies. Tariffs imposed on imported components-ranging from precision optics to specialized clamp assemblies-have elevated landed costs by an average of 12 percent, prompting manufacturers to reassess supplier relationships. In response, many have accelerated local component production or explored low-tariff trade corridors, such as preferential agreements within the Americas.

Concurrently, end users are reevaluating total cost of ownership models to absorb higher capital expenditures without compromising ROI. Service providers report a surge in demand for retrofit kits and upgrade packages that convert existing semi-automatic machines into fully automated workstations, thereby mitigating the need for full system replacements. As a result, aftermarket services and spares have become critical profit centers, delivering short-term relief while long-term supply realignment takes shape.

Key Segmentation Insights for Automatic Splicing Equipment

In examining application-driven demand, the aerospace sector-encompassing aircraft cabling, avionics systems, and engine wiring-continues to drive specifications for ultra-reliable splice quality under extreme environmental conditions. Automotive manufacturers rely on chassis assembly, interior and exterior wiring, and wire harnessing lines that demand high cycle rates and rapid changeover. Electronics and electricals applications, including circuit board assembly, component integration, and connector clippings, necessitate sub-millisecond alignment accuracy and contamination-free splices. In the medical device arena, diagnostic equipment interfaces, patient monitoring devices, and X-ray equipment cabling require biocompatible materials and traceable quality controls, while telecommunications installations spanning cable TV networks, fiber optic runs, and telephone systems emphasize low insertion losses and long-term signal integrity.

From an end-user perspective, contract manufacturers serving aerospace component and electrical equipment markets often prioritize flexible machine configurations and quick tooling swaps. Original equipment manufacturers in the automotive and consumer electronics segments focus on fully automated cells with integrated vision systems for zero-defect output. Research and development facilities-spanning prototyping labs and specialized testing centers-demand semi-automatic systems that allow manual intervention during process refinement.

On the basis of machine type, fully automatic platforms equipped with advanced interface systems and programmable logic controls excel in high-volume production, whereas semi-automatic units with assisted loading and manual setting adjustments are more prevalent in low-to-medium volume or specialized runs. Product differentiation also emerges through bench-mounted models offering fixed-length cutting and stationary interfacing in controlled environments, contrasted with portable solutions designed for field utility and on-site repairs under variable conditions.

Technological variations further segment the market: electro-mechanical approaches leverage precision cutting engines and servo motors to deliver consistent force profiles, while ultrasonic welding methods utilize high frequency vibrations and intermetallic bonding to create molecular-level joins. Finally, component-based distinctions highlight controllers and interface systems that incorporate embedded software and touchscreen controls; cutting and clamp devices engineered around blade mechanisms and pneumatic clamps; and power system units utilizing either high-capacity battery arrays or robust electric drivetrains to power remote or central configurations.

Key Regional Insights Shaping Demand Dynamics

Within the Americas, the United States and Canada lead adoption rates by integrating automatic splicing technologies into automotive, aerospace, and telecommunications supply chains, supported by strong aftermarket service networks. Mexico’s growing presence in automotive harness manufacturing has also catalyzed equipment investments along the US–Mexico corridor. Europe remains a hotbed for precision machinery, with Germany, France, and Italy spearheading automotive and aerospace applications; regulatory alignment across the European Union further streamlines cross-border machine deployments. In the Middle East, infrastructure development projects in the United Arab Emirates and Saudi Arabia are driving demand for field-portable and bench-mounted splicing units.

Africa’s telecommunications expansion has fueled a parallel need for fiber optic splicing equipment, particularly in urban centers where network densification is paramount. In the Asia-Pacific region, China’s robust electronics manufacturing clusters, Japan’s legacy in precision robotics, South Korea’s semiconductor and automotive hubs, and India’s rapidly expanding cable network installations collectively reinforce the region’s leadership in splicing machine procurement. Australia and Southeast Asia, buoyed by government-sponsored digital transformation initiatives, round out a diverse and dynamic regional picture.

Key Company Insights and Competitive Positioning

Major original equipment and component suppliers from Asia dominate the competitive landscape, each leveraging proprietary technologies and global distribution channels. China Potevio Co., Ltd. delivers a broad portfolio of electro-mechanical splicing systems tailored for fiber optic applications, while DarkhorseChina (Shenzhen Yuwei Precision Equipment Co., Ltd.) emphasizes high-speed automation and custom software interfaces. Fujikura Ltd. and Furukawa Electric Co., Ltd. bring decades of expertise in fiber alignment optics and ultrasonic welding platforms, supported by extensive after-sales support networks.

Hytera Communications Corporation Limited has expanded into splicing solutions for public safety radio and digital trunking systems, leveraging its telecommunication equipment heritage. INNO Instruments Inc. and JILONG Optical Communication Co., Ltd. are recognized for their handheld fusion splicers and ruggedized designs for field service technicians. LXN Optical Instruments Co., Ltd. and Shenzhen Ruiyan Communication Equipment Co., Ltd. combine cost-effective hardware with cloud-enabled monitoring modules, appealing to budget-sensitive operators.

Signal Fire Technology Co., Ltd. distinguishes itself with integrated data analytics for splice quality reporting, while Sumitomo Electric Industries, Ltd. and Sumitomo Electric Lightwave Corporation benefit from a legacy in precision drawing and cabling to offer turnkey splicing cells. Yokogawa Electric Corporation rounds out the field, integrating advanced process control philosophies and remote operation capabilities into its bench-mounted and portable platforms. Collectively, these players emphasize modular architectures, rapid deployment, and service-driven revenue models to maintain competitive edge.

Actionable Recommendations for Industry Leaders

Industry leaders should prioritize investment in advanced sensor fusion and machine-learning algorithms to enhance splice consistency and reduce setup times. By adopting modular hardware architectures, manufacturers can accelerate customization and minimize downtime during product line changes. Strategic partnerships with robotics integrators and software developers will streamline system integration and enable turnkey solutions for end users.

Supply chain resilience remains crucial; diversifying component sources and establishing near-shoring arrangements within key trade blocs can buffer against unexpected tariff fluctuations. Equally, embedding predictive maintenance capabilities and remote diagnostics will reduce unplanned outages and extend equipment lifecycles, thereby lowering total cost of ownership.

On the human capital front, upskilling technicians in programming logic controllers, vision systems, and ultrasonic welding parameters will foster operational excellence. Collaborative pilot programs with end users can surface process optimizations and accelerate feedback loops for continuous improvement. Finally, companies should explore service-as-a-subscription models, combining equipment financing, preventive maintenance, and real-time performance monitoring to cultivate long-term customer relationships.
